Meet Trescha Kay, a speech-language pathologist who specializes in geriatric cognition and gender-affirming voice therapy. Trescha shares her story, explaining what it was like working in SNF facilities for six years and how she made the move to academia. She also shares what gender-affirming voice therapy entails and offers advice for new clinicians.
